PERIODICAL INSPECTION

All ropes courses and adventure facilities must undergo periodic inspections to ensure ongoing safety, compliance with standards, and protection of users and staff. 
A periodic inspection is a comprehensive, qualified assessment carried out by a trained and experienced inspector at defined intervals.

When to Inspect? 

Periodicla inspections are required each calander year, 

Who to Inspect?

The inspection body needs to be fully certified for the scope of the inspection​. 

Certification

The Periodical  inspection should be carried out in accordance with the EN 15567-1

INSPECTION INCLUDES

WHAT IS INSPECTED? 

Visual inspection

A visual inspection of all components of the structure at.

Structural integrity

Full structural stability assessment whether this is timber poles, steel or tree based

 Documentation

Verify the PPE inspection Log and the Operational and Routine Visual inspection logs

Functional inspection

A functional inspection of all the elments needs to be preformed at height.

components

Assessment of worn components and requirements for their replacement

Inspection report

after the inspection a full inspection report in accordance to EN 15567-1 is deliverd .
